The core message is that insecurity in one's relationship with God leads to conflict in horizontal relationships with others. True security comes from understanding that God is a loving Father, not a strict policeman, and that forgiveness is secured solely through the blood of Jesus, not through repeated confession or self-punishment. Repentance—a change of mind away from sin—is the necessary act, which, when sincere, requires only one confession.

The message emphasizes the need for believers to be constantly prepared for the Lord's return, drawing parallels from scripture passages like Luke 12 and Matthew 25. True readiness goes beyond mere knowledge or outward appearance; it requires an intimate, personal relationship with Christ, symbolized by the oil the wise virgins possessed. Ultimately, one must be found *by* Him, indicating a deep, known relationship rather than just claiming to know Him.

The message emphasizes that God's promises are unfailing, citing scripture like Matthew 24:35 and Isaiah 55:10-11 to prove that God's word will surely accomplish what He sends. The speaker encourages listeners to trust God's word, even when circumstances are chaotic, and warns that unbelief and unconfessed sin are what hold God's hand back. True assurance comes from the Holy Spirit confirming God's truth in our hearts.
